Embodiment 1
[0051] The present embodiment provides a kind of GSM-R emergency system 1, such as figure 1 As shown, the GSM-R emergency system 1 includes an on-site mobile emergency terminal 11 and an emergency management center 12, and the on-site mobile emergency terminal 11 includes an image acquisition encoder 111 and a main control terminal 112, wherein the image acquisition encoder 111 includes an image acquisition device 1111, an encoding module 1112, and a first communication module 1113; the main control terminal 112 includes a second communication module 1121, a main control CPU 1122, a GSM-R-based dual-channel wireless transmission module 1123, and an intelligent power supply 1114; The emergency management center 12 includes an emergency management server 121 , and the emergency management server 121 includes a client 1211 , a server 1212 , and a database 1213 .

Embodiment 2
[0072] This embodiment provides a kind of GSM-R emergency method, and described GSM-R emergency method comprises:
